Ashurst partner heads to Jones Day

Jones Day has recruited an energy transactions partner, who joins from Ashurst, to its Perth office.

Adam Conway has joined the Jones Days Perth office as a partner in its energy practice. His new role will see him lead the team’s energy and resources transactional work in the WA capital.

Mr Conway brings with him more than 20 years’ experience representing a clients across a range of sectors, including mining, and upstream and downstream energy. 

Throughout his career, he has advised on all aspects of mining projects including tenure, exploration, logistics, joint venture issues, farm-ins, tolling arrangements, asset acquisition and divestment, off-take agreements, contract disputes and energy supply, according to a statement from Jones Day.

In addition, the firm noted that Mr Conway’s recent work has involved assisting on a range of commodities including gold, iron ore, nickel, spodumene, mineral sands, vanadium, uranium, rare earths and iron oxide copper gold.

“Adam is an outstanding addition to our global energy team and is the ideal person to lead the Energy and Resources side of the practice as we continue to grow in Perth,” said Simon Bellas, partner-in-charge of Jones Day's Perth Office.

“Given the outlook for increased project and transactional activity in the energy and resources sectors, it is an opportune time to build our energy and resources transactional capabilities. Adam will drive those efforts for us, and I look forward to his contributions.”

Chris Ahern, partner-in-charge of Jones Day in Australia and Japan offered a similar sentiment.

“Our Perth Office has one of the leading energy and resources disputes practice in the region,” Mr Ahern said.

“The addition of Adam to our transactional capabilities sends a very clear message to the market that Jones Day remains committed to the region, and to providing access to top-tier representation for our energy clients no matter what their specific needs.”
